The Sahara Intercept
1980: Ross Brannan is back and out for revenge β determined to hunt down the traitor, J. Andrew Marsden β at any cost. The Ε korpion Brigade, a band of German terrorists, teams up with Libyan Dictator Gadhafi and rogue ex-CIA operatives in an explosive plot to obtain nuclear materials.
Marsden is rumored to be in Libya. Ross and a multi-national team are dispatched to find Marsden's base of operations. In an instant the mission is compromised, and Ross is propelled on a roller-coaster ride across Africa.
